My passion is working with those that are looking for a safe place to explore the challenges that life brings. My focus is to create an environment for my clients to embrace hope and reach their goals. I have worked with victims of domestic abuse, trafficking, and sexual abuse since 2016. I also work with clients that are struggling with anxiety and depression. I believe that my client is the expert in their life and that together we can get them back to leading their lives effectively.
I utilize an eclectic approach to therapy. I believe in an individualized approach to therapy for each of my clients. I will use different types of modalities that will be most useful to the client. I am trained in EMDR for those that are interested in that approach.
I believe that as we work together- hope and clarity will come as well.
